怎么自學編程設(shè)計游戲人物,自學編程該如何入手?
其實編程語言的很多思想都是相通的,在時間有限的情況下,通過一個或幾個小項目的訓練可以幫助你比較快的梳理編程的思路,在這里向題主推薦《我的第一本編程書》這本書。
這本書通過一個將不斷下落的方塊排列整齊的游戲,講解一個小游戲項目中涉及到的編程知識。在對編程語言不精通的情況下,可以先通過這本書提供的案例,使用專用的編程語言體驗項目流程并學習做小項目的編程思路,了解各種知識點的用途。
具體到編程語言的學習,在這里推薦一些比較適合初學者學習的編程語言書籍。希望能對題主有所幫助。
C語言是編程者的入門語言,也是許多大學的第一門程序設(shè)計課程。如果題主未來想從事編程方面的工作,學習C語言還是非常必要的,《“笨辦法”學C語言》這本書比較適合初學者。
這本書的內(nèi)容十分淺顯易懂,通過52個習題來講解C語言的相關(guān)知識,每個習題都配了視頻,更加方便讀者操作,并保證程序能正確運行。
如果你覺得《“笨辦法”學C語言》這本書的難易程度還能接受的話,也可以再嘗試閱讀一下《C Primer Plus 第6版 中文版》這本書,挑戰(zhàn)一下自己的能力。
C語言主要是用于小規(guī)模程序的開發(fā),對于計算量較大的程序而言,C++是更好的選擇。不過初中編程者學習C++還是有一定難度的,如果題主想進行更深入的研究,可以嘗試一下《C++ Primer Plus(第6版)中文版》這本書,看看能否更進一步。
除了C/C++以外,Java和Python也是目前比較主流的編程語言,題主可以通過學習《漫畫面向?qū)ο缶幊蘆ava語言版》、《教孩子學編程(Python語言版)》、《Python趣味編程入門》中的一些簡單案例來了解不同編程語言的特點。
怎樣用計算器編程打cs?
首先,推薦一款功能強大的可編程計算器:CASIO fx-5800P編程計算器;
你說的這個場景, 貌似在電視劇《少年派》里實現(xiàn)過,真實是否存在熱仍有待證明;不過小編有心,在度娘中搜到了有關(guān)案例,還真有牛人實現(xiàn)了,讓我們來看看轉(zhuǎn)自搜狐游戲的消息:
自從大規(guī)模集成電路被廣泛應(yīng)用于計算機制造業(yè)之后,硬件的性能就得到了大幅度的提升,即使小如計算器,也可以提供不俗的性能,于是……技術(shù)宅們行動了,只要你有德州儀器的TI-83/84/89型號的計算器,就可以到calculatorti.com下載相應(yīng)的固件包,然后可以玩到《超級馬里奧》、《口袋妖怪》、《俄羅斯方塊》甚至《毀滅戰(zhàn)士》和《反恐精英》這樣的游戲!
我們已經(jīng)知道代碼寫在文本文件里面后,如何被編碼成為二進制程序,然后被執(zhí)行的過程。合理的代碼能夠最大限度的發(fā)揮編譯器的優(yōu)化性能,從而使代碼更高效的執(zhí)行。了解處理器的運行機理,能夠突破編譯器的局限性,進一步提高代碼執(zhí)行效率。
使用普通的函數(shù)計算器進行簡單的編程。計算器編程可以完成的事包括但不限于:各種數(shù)列求和、求積等運算,牛頓解方程,猜數(shù)字、理財游戲等等。 掌握這個技巧,可以秒殺一些特定類型的題目。在上課無聊時也能寫個小游戲消遣消遣。
新手程序員如何自我提升?
對于新入職場的程序員而言,要提升自己的編程能力,我從一個老程序員的角度,給你以下幾個方面的建議:
1.養(yǎng)成良好的編程習慣。
萬丈高樓平地起,基本功很重要。新手一定要耐住性子,從注釋、縮進、變量命名這些最最基礎(chǔ)的做起,培養(yǎng)自己良好的編程習慣。
2.熟悉軟件工程的思想
軟件開發(fā)是一個團隊協(xié)作的工作,熟悉團隊開發(fā)的一些工具和思想,對于你未來在工作中與同事合作,會有很大的幫助。
3.提高自己的理論水平
軟件開發(fā)是用計算機語言表達自己思想的一個過程。軟件中常用的:分治、遞歸等基本思想要了解。設(shè)計模式的設(shè)計原則也要熟記。總之,多看書提升自己的理論水平。
4.廣泛涉獵
例如:對大數(shù)據(jù)、云計算、物聯(lián)網(wǎng)、AI、區(qū)塊鏈等前衛(wèi)到技術(shù)原理要懂。
5.多學習業(yè)務(wù)知識
這一點很重要,業(yè)務(wù)是技術(shù)的前提。這也是程序員進階架構(gòu)師必須掌握的能力。對常見的電商系統(tǒng)、ERP系統(tǒng)、CRM系統(tǒng)、客服系統(tǒng)等有哪些大的業(yè)務(wù)模塊,模塊之間的關(guān)系是什么,掌握的越多越好。
6.鍛煉自己寫文檔的能力
軟件開發(fā)前面的階段是設(shè)計階段,重視自己的文檔能力,對于復雜的業(yè)務(wù)問題轉(zhuǎn)化為計算機問題,是至關(guān)重要的。
最后,祝你在編程的道路上,一帆風順。
以上就是關(guān)于怎么自學編程設(shè)計游戲人物和自學編程該如何入手的相關(guān)問題解答,希望對你有所幫助。